Servicing Technology builds and runs the systems Rocket Mortgage clients use to manage their mortgage after closing - payments, escrow, payoffs, and the support experiences around them. As Team Leader, Engineering (AI Enablement and Developer Tooling), you will lead the team that builds the tooling, accelerators, and shared engineering systems that make it faster and safer for every team in the Organization to build and operate AI-powered software.
You remove friction for the engineering teams you support through self-service tooling, reusable patterns, automation, and strong feedback loops. This is a builder's role in a space that is still being defined: you will shape what this team owns, earn credibility with senior engineers, and influence architectural decisions well beyond your direct reports.
About the Role
  • Lead, mentor, and grow a team that owns AI enablement, developer tooling, and reusable accelerators for Servicing Technology
  • Stay hands-on - review code, prototype, and work with AI-assisted development yourself, setting the engineering quality bar by example rather than by directive
  • Build the internal tools, automation, workflows, and reference implementations that remove friction and measurably improve engineering productivity across Servicing teams
  • Drive real adoption of AI capabilities - shared patterns, evaluation, experimentation support, and production-readiness guidance - so teams ship AI-powered software confidently rather than experimentally
  • Raise the bar on observability, resilience, incident learning, automation, and reduction of operational toil across Servicing Technology
  • Turn ambiguous problems into clear ownership, decisions, and measurable outcomes, partnering with engineering, security, product, and senior leadership to align on AI strategy and infrastructure investment

About You
Minimum Qualifications
  • Have led a team whose output was consumed by other engineering teams - a shared capability, tool, or platform - rather than a single application or an operational function
  • Engineering leadership experience managing technical teams, including hiring, developing engineers, and setting technical direction
  • Strong technical depth in distributed systems, cloud infrastructure, or software delivery - enough to challenge architecture and earn credibility with senior engineers
  • Hands-on coding ability - you still write and review code, and can reason through a problem in a codebase alongside your engineers
  • Credible, practical understanding of modern production AI: LLMs, RAG, agents, model APIs, evaluation, lifecycle management, governance, and cost
  • Proven ability to create clarity in ambiguous spaces - establishing ownership, driving work through completion, and showing measurable outcomes
  • Excellent communication and cross-team influence, with the ability to explain complex technical tradeoffs to engineers, security partners, product, and executives

Preferred Qualifications
  • Built or led developer tooling, shared engineering capabilities, or developer productivity programs at scale
  • Productionized AI or LLM capabilities, or led AI enablement initiatives across multiple engineering teams
  • Drove measurable adoption of a shared capability across multiple teams - not just delivery of it
  • Strong awareness of how the wider industry is solving these problems, with a track record of adapting proven practices thoughtfully rather than copying them; contributions to the broader engineering community (open source, writing, speaking, standards) are a plus

Also useful, though not required: agent frameworks, AI evaluation and tracing, model routing or inference-cost optimization, and AI security, governance, and safety practices.
The question we keep coming back to: show us something you built that materially changed how other engineers build or operate software.

About u s
Rocket is a Detroit-based company made up of businesses that provide simple, fast and trusted digital solutions for complex transactions. The name comes from our flagship business, now known as Rocket Mortgage®, which was founded in 1985. Today, we're a publicly traded company involved in many different industries, including mortgages, fintech, real estate and more. We're insistently different in how we look at the world and are committed to an inclusive workplace where every voice is heard.
